Volvo Trucks establishes leasing system

Oct 1, 2003 12:00 PM

Volvo Trucks North America Inc has created the Volvo Truck Leasing System (VTLS) to serve the trucking industry's need for full-service truck leasing and rental, and has a system of 160 service locations across North America.

Through VTLS, a complete line of Volvo trucks and a full menu of customizable offerings are available, including contract maintenance, full-service leases, finance leases, and truck rentals. VTLS members also offer support services such as parts, tax service, tires, permits, licensing, fuel cards, road service, insurance, and credit cards.

Besides providing Volvo leasing and support, each location will provide service for both Volvo and Mack vehicles in the leasing system.

Terry Dubowick director of Mack Leasing System, is the head of VTLS, which initially consists of the members of the existing Mack Leasing System. Of those dealers, 23 are Volvo Truck dealers.
